What is Hamas
Hamas, those in charge of last Saturday’s bloody attack and Israel’s main objective is a Palestinian political and military organization who governs the Gaza Strip. It was formed in 1987 and its main objective is the liberation of Gazadestroy Israel and replace it with an Islamic State.
This is not the first armed conflict between Hamas and Israel. since the Islamic organization seized power in Gaza in 2007. Between those wars, Hamas has fired or allowed other groups to fire thousands of rockets into Israel, and carried out other deadly attacks. Israel has also repeatedly attacked Hamas with airstrikes and, together with Egypt, has blockaded the Gaza Strip since 2007.
Hamas as a whole, or in some cases its military wing, is considered a terrorist group for Israel, United States, European Union and United Kingdom, as well as by other world powers. Furthermore, it should be noted that the Hamas military organization does not act alone since it has the support of Iran, which finances it and provides it with weapons and training.
Why are they attacking now?
The Hamas attack last Saturday occurred unexpectedly and without warning, but the Israeli-Palestinian conflict has continued over time and It has taken place at a time of increasing tensions between Israelis and Palestinians. Furthermore, the militia operation took place during the Israeli holiday of Simchat Torah and, curiously, just one day after the 50th anniversary of the start of the Arab-Israeli war in 1973, known as Yom Kippur by Israelis, which lasted three weeks.
There are many factors that must be taken into account when analyzing the conflict, but it is worth highlighting that this year has been the deadliest in history for Palestinians West Bank, occupied by Israel, which could have motivated Hamas to hit Israel. According to the BBC, it is also possible that Hamas wanted to score a important propaganda victory against Israel to increase its popularity among ordinary Palestinians.
On the other hand, Israel already had some 4,500 Palestinians held in Israeli prisons and Hamas could have taken so many Israelis prisoner in order to press for his release.
Experts also raise the possibility that the attack was orchestrated by Iran, despite the fact that the Iranian ambassador to the UN has denied his country’s involvement. In this sense, Iran and Hamas are also firmly opposed to the growing prospect of a historic peace agreement between Israel and Saudi Arabia, and Israel’s military response could play into their interests if the attacks provoke widespread anger in the Arab world.
